Dondrea Tillman sure is a ballhawk.
For the second time this season, the Broncos big outside linebacker picked off a quarterback, this time off of pass by Geno Smith that deflected off of Ashton Jeanty’s hands.
And like the last time, Tillman rumbled down the field for a 23-yard return.
As columnist Sean Keeler pointed out in the live game updates, Tillman leads the Broncos in interceptions.
The score was 7-7 at that point.
